Bill Summary
A MEMORIAL REQUESTING THE GOVERNOR TO DECLARE SEPTEMBER 23, 2022 "FOURTH TRIMESTER CARE DAY" IN NEW MEXICO. .
AI Summary
This Memorial requests the Governor to declare September 23, 2022, as "Fourth Trimester Care Day" in New Mexico, recognizing that the first three months after childbirth, referred to as the "fourth trimester," is a critical period of significant physical, hormonal, and psychosocial transformation for new mothers that requires dedicated care and support. The Memorial highlights that current healthcare practices often focus more on pregnancy and birth, with limited postpartum follow-up, leaving many mothers to struggle with undiagnosed and untreated physical and mental health issues, such as breastfeeding difficulties, depression, anxiety, and physical pain, which can negatively impact their well-being and their ability to care for their infants. It emphasizes the interconnectedness of maternal and infant health and advocates for comprehensive support for mothers during this transitional phase, noting that organizations like physical therapists can play a role in postpartum recovery.
